Test Plan Note — Webhook Retry Semantics (Fernwhistle Dispatch)

Purpose: confirm that failed deliveries back off exponentially (1m, 5m, 25m) and stop after five attempts, marking the endpoint as suspended. Support should check that suspended endpoints surface a clear banner in the merchant console and that manual redelivery resets the counter. Run these checks against staging only, authenticating with the bearer token below.

session JWT of hahif-fawif = eyJhbGciOiJIUzI1NiIsInR5cCI6IkpXVCJ9.eyJzdWIiOiI04_V2KayaDIn0.-jKHPhS5t5LS

Handing off the Quillbus broker upgrade (4.x to 5.1) to Dario. Cluster is half-migrated; mixed-version mode is supported but TLS cert rotation must finish before cutover. No auth model changes, though the admin API gained two new endpoints worth reviewing. Open questions and the migration checklist are tracked on the internal page below.

dashboard of taduf-bawef = https://jira.lumicsys.internal/projects/display/browse/b1cbf89d

### Checklist Item 7 — Flaky DNS Resolution in Quillhaven Edge Fleet

Confirm the intermittent resolver timeouts observed in the Quillhaven edge nodes have a tracked remediation plan: verify retry budgets are configured, the fallback resolver list is current, and cache TTL settings match the runbook. On-call should validate that the synthetic lookup probe alerts within two minutes of degradation. Accountability for closing this item sits with the engineer named below.

account owner for bawip-tahag: Raleth Quenok

**Mgmt Meeting Minutes — Retiring the Brightline Range**

Quick recap for sales leads at Fenholt Supplies: we agreed to retire the Brightline fixture range by year-end. Remaining stock moves to clearance pricing next month, and accounts on standing orders get migrated to the Lumetta range. Trade-in incentives were approved in principle. The confidential note on next steps sits just below.

board note of bajof-bajeg: The pricing group signed off on a budget of $13.4 million for Project Sildor. The renewal with Lamixek Holdings closes at $48.9 million a year, 49 percent above the last contract.